Muscle Milk/Toyota/JGRMX Steel City Results

HUNTERSVILLE, N.C. (Sept. 3, 2011) – Just one week after Irene soaked the sands of Southwick the sun was shining at Steel City Raceway in Delmont, Pa. for the penultimate round of the 2011 AMA Pro Motocross Championship Series. The track is coined “Steel City” due to its proximity to Pittsburgh, just one hour away.

Davi Millsaps continues to improve after his knee surgery and is training regularly and expecting to begin riding again very soon. Les Smith will continue to substitute for Millsaps through the end of the season.

Both Justin Brayton and Smith started the first moto in the top-10 with Brayton seventh and Smith 10th. Throughout the 30-minute plus two lap race Brayton maintained seventh with Smith at times inside the top-10 and at others just outside of it. In the final laps Smith drifted back to 14th.

When the second moto left the gate Brayton rounded the first turn in eighth with Smith unfortunately buried in the 40-rider field with his work cut out for him. On the fourth lap Brayton moved forward into seventh. Smith fought his way into the top-20, and then all the way up to 12th. Ultimately both Brayton and Smith would repeat their previous moto finishes, with Brayton seventh and Smith 14th. Interestingly, Brayton’s seven – seven moto scores earned him seventh overall, with Smiths 14 – 14 results giving him 14th for the day.
